class TocTree(Directive):
|
|
"""
|
|
Directive to notify Sphinx about the hierarchical structure of the docs,
|
|
and to include a table-of-contents like tree in the current document.
|
|
"""
|
|
has_content = True
|
|
required_arguments = 0
|
|
optional_arguments = 0
|
|
final_argument_whitespace = False
|
|
option_spec = {
|
|
'maxdepth': int,
|
|
'name': str,
|
|
'glob': directives.flag,
|
|
'hidden': directives.flag,
|
|
'includehidden': directives.flag,
|
|
'numbered': int_or_nothing,
|
|
'titlesonly': directives.flag,
|
|
}
|
|
|
|
def run(self):
|
|
env = self.state.document.settings.env
|
|
suffixes = env.config.source_suffix
|
|
glob = 'glob' in self.options
|
|
name = self.options.get('name')
|
|
|
|
ret = []
|
|
# (title, ref) pairs, where ref may be a document, or an external link,
|
|
# and title may be None if the document's title is to be used
|
|
entries = []
|
|
includefiles = []
|
|
all_docnames = env.found_docs.copy()
|
|
# don't add the currently visited file in catch-all patterns
|
|
all_docnames.remove(env.docname)
|
|
for entry in self.content:
|
|
if not entry:
|
|
continue
|
|
if glob and ('*' in entry or '?' in entry or '[' in entry):
|
|
patname = docname_join(env.docname, entry)
|
|
docnames = sorted(patfilter(all_docnames, patname))
|
|
for docname in docnames:
|
|
all_docnames.remove(docname) # don't include it again
|
|
entries.append((None, docname))
|
|
includefiles.append(docname)
|
|
if not docnames:
|
|
ret.append(self.state.document.reporter.warning(
|
|
'toctree glob pattern %r didn\'t match any documents'
|
|
% entry, line=self.lineno))
|
|
else:
|
|
# look for explicit titles ("Some Title <document>")
|
|
m = explicit_title_re.match(entry)
|
|
if m:
|
|
ref = m.group(2)
|
|
title = m.group(1)
|
|
docname = ref
|
|
else:
|
|
ref = docname = entry
|
|
title = None
|
|
# remove suffixes (backwards compatibility)
|
|
for suffix in suffixes:
|
|
if docname.endswith(suffix):
|
|
docname = docname[:-len(suffix)]
|
|
break
|
|
# absolutize filenames
|
|
docname = docname_join(env.docname, docname)
|
|
if url_re.match(ref) or ref == 'self':
|
|
entries.append((title, ref))
|
|
elif docname not in env.found_docs:
|
|
ret.append(self.state.document.reporter.warning(
|
|
'toctree contains reference to nonexisting '
|
|
'document %r' % docname, line=self.lineno))
|
|
env.note_reread()
|
|
else:
|
|
all_docnames.discard(docname)
|
|
entries.append((title, docname))
|
|
includefiles.append(docname)
|
|
subnode = addnodes.toctree()
|
|
subnode['parent'] = env.docname
|
|
# entries contains all entries (self references, external links etc.)
|
|
subnode['entries'] = entries
|
|
# includefiles only entries that are documents
|
|
subnode['includefiles'] = includefiles
|
|
subnode['maxdepth'] = self.options.get('maxdepth', -1)
|
|
subnode['name'] = name
|
|
subnode['glob'] = glob
|
|
subnode['hidden'] = 'hidden' in self.options
|
|
subnode['includehidden'] = 'includehidden' in self.options
|
|
subnode['numbered'] = self.options.get('numbered', 0)
|
|
subnode['titlesonly'] = 'titlesonly' in self.options
|
|
set_source_info(self, subnode)
|
|
wrappernode = nodes.compound(classes=['toctree-wrapper'])
|
|
wrappernode.append(subnode)
|
|
ret.append(wrappernode)
|
|
return ret

class Only(Directive):
|
|
"""
|
|
Directive to only include text if the given tag(s) are enabled.
|
|
"""
|
|
has_content = True
|
|
required_arguments = 1
|
|
optional_arguments = 0
|
|
final_argument_whitespace = True
|
|
option_spec = {}
|
|
|
|
def run(self):
|
|
node = addnodes.only()
|
|
node.document = self.state.document
|
|
set_source_info(self, node)
|
|
node['expr'] = self.arguments[0]
|
|
|
|
# Same as util.nested_parse_with_titles but try to handle nested
|
|
# sections which should be raised higher up the doctree.
|
|
surrounding_title_styles = self.state.memo.title_styles
|
|
surrounding_section_level = self.state.memo.section_level
|
|
self.state.memo.title_styles = []
|
|
self.state.memo.section_level = 0
|
|
try:
|
|
self.state.nested_parse(self.content, self.content_offset,
|
|
node, match_titles=1)
|
|
title_styles = self.state.memo.title_styles
|
|
if (not surrounding_title_styles
|
|
or not title_styles
|
|
or title_styles[0] not in surrounding_title_styles
|
|
or not self.state.parent):
|
|
# No nested sections so no special handling needed.
|
|
return [node]
|
|
# Calculate the depths of the current and nested sections.
|
|
current_depth = 0
|
|
parent = self.state.parent
|
|
while parent:
|
|
current_depth += 1
|
|
parent = parent.parent
|
|
current_depth -= 2
|
|
title_style = title_styles[0]
|
|
nested_depth = len(surrounding_title_styles)
|
|
if title_style in surrounding_title_styles:
|
|
nested_depth = surrounding_title_styles.index(title_style)
|
|
# Use these depths to determine where the nested sections should
|
|
# be placed in the doctree.
|
|
n_sects_to_raise = current_depth - nested_depth + 1
|
|
parent = self.state.parent
|
|
for i in range(n_sects_to_raise):
|
|
if parent.parent:
|
|
parent = parent.parent
|
|
parent.append(node)
|
|
return []
|
|
finally:
|
|
self.state.memo.title_styles = surrounding_title_styles
|
|
self.state.memo.section_level = surrounding_section_level
